  • Description Vinorelbine is a semisynthetic vinca alkaloid differing from vinblastine in the catharantine moiety of the molecule. It is claimed to have a broad spectrum of action both in vifro and in vivo; clinically it has been found effective in the treatment of non-small cell lung cancer, advanced breast cancer, ovarian cancer and Hodgkins disease.
  • Uses antimigraine, 5HT[1B/1D] agonist Vinorelbine base is an antineoplastic agent with anti-mitotic properties.
  • Therapeutic Function Antineoplastic
  • Clinical Use Vinorelbine is particularly useful in the treatment of advanced non–small cell lung cancer and can be administered alone or in combination with cisplatin. It is thought to interfere with mitosis in dividing cells through a relatively specific action on mitotic microtubules.
  • Drug interactions Potentially hazardous interactions with other drugs Antibacterials: increased risk of neutropenia with clarithromycin; possible increased risk of ventricular arrhythmias with delamanid. Antifungals: metabolism possibly inhibited by itraconazole, increased risk of neurotoxicity. Antimalarials: avoid with piperaquine with artenimol. Antipsychotics: avoid concomitant use with clozapine (increased risk of agranulocytosis).
